DEL 7410 Education Policy, Law, and Ethics in the Virtual Environment

Course Number:DEL 7410
 
Course Name:Education Policy, Law, and Ethics in the Virtual Environment
 
Course Description:   Students will examine higher education law and policy beginning with a basic understanding of the American legal system, how policies are created, and ethical implications as well as exploring institutional accountability and the rights and responsibilities of students and faculty. This course draws from real-life cases in American universities and provides knowledge and tools to effectively respond in an environment of increasing litigation.
